Silicon Motion Technology Corporation (SMI) is the Taiwan-based powerhouse behind a staggering percentage of the world’s SSD controllers, particularly in the value and mid-range segments. While high-end drives boast controllers from Phison or in-house designs (Samsung, WD), SMI controllers—the SM2246, SM2258, SM2259, and the more advanced SM2262 and SM2263—form the backbone of countless OEM, portable, and third-party SSDs.
The "SM32x" and "SM34x" designations in the essay title refer to two distinct eras:
Despite their architectural differences, both families share a common soul: a proprietary firmware and a factory initialization process governed exclusively by the MPTOOL. smi mptool sm32x sm34x smi mass production tool
Before downloading any tool, you must identify your controller. Using the wrong MPTool can brick your device.
The SMI Mass Production Tool (MPTool) is a firmware flashing and configuration utility designed by Silicon Motion, Inc. (SMI) for its USB flash drive controllers. It is used primarily in manufacturing and repair environments to: The tool is specifically tailored for SMI controller
The tool is specifically tailored for SMI controller families SM32x and SM34x, which are common in USB 2.0 and USB 3.0 flash drives.
| Family | Common Controllers | USB Speed | |--------|--------------------|------------| | SM32x | SM321, SM324, SM325, SM326, SM327 | USB 2.0 / USB 3.0 | | SM34x | SM341, SM342, SM343, SM346, SM349 | USB 3.0 / USB 3.1 | Kingston (some models)
These controllers are widely used in budget to mid-range flash drives from brands like PNY, Kingston (some models), ADATA, Transcend, and generic OEM drives.